Launched to celebrate the Spring Festival, the Fortune & Colors event is the most recent installment of this tradition of themed event challenges. New missions are now available in the game for players to complete and play a new Clash of Dancing Lions game mode to gain Danqing, a unique currency for unlocking rewards in the Fortune & Colors event pass. Here are all the quests and rewards in the game you can now unlock.

Every Marvel Rivals Fortune and Colors mission and reward

In Marvel Rivals’ Fortune & Colors event that began on January 23, 2025, players must use Danqing to color the on-screen scroll in order to receive free cosmetic goodies from the event pass. Players can buy Danqing for Units commencing February 6th, 2025 at 9 AM UTC until the event ends on February 14. Collecting Danqing can be difficult right now because there are only two missions issued daily.

Here are all the active missions and rewards you can unlock in the pass:

Fortune & Colors Missions and Danqing rewards

  • Win 1 Clash of Dancing Lions match(es) (1) – 40 Danqing
  • Complete 3 Clash of Dancing Lions match(es) (3) – 100 Danqing
  • Pass the ball 1 times in a single Clash of Dancing Lions match (1) – 40 Danqing
  • Win 1 Clash of Dancing Lions match(es) (1) – 40 Danqing
  • Pass the ball a total of 5 times in Clash of Dancing Lions (5) – 100 Danqing
  • Complete 2 Clash of Dancing Lions match(es) – 40 Danqing
  • Intercept the ball  3 times in a single Clash of Dancing Lions match (3) – 40 Danqing
  • Score 1 points in a single Clash of Dancing Lions match (1) – 40 Danqing
  • Intercept the ball a total of 10 times in Clash of Dancing Lions (10) – 100 Danqing
  • Score 1 points in a single Clash of Dancing Lions match (1) – 40 Danqing
  • Intercept the ball  3 times in a single Clash of Dancing Lions match (3) – 40 Danqing
  • Score 5 points in Clash of Dancing Lions (5) – 100 Danqing

Once you’ve gathered the Danqing, head to your home screen and click on the Fortune & Colors tab on the left side of the screen. Then, check the amount of Danqing you have in order to color the scroll and unlock the rewards in the pass. Here are all the cosmetic rewards you can unlock using Danqing:

Fortune & Colors event pass rewards

  • Drum and Roar Nameplate – Unlock with 100 Danqing
  • Snake’s Luck Spray – Unlock with 200 Danqing
  • 200 Chrono Tokens – Unlock with 300 Danqing
  • Lion’s Mane Nameplate – Unlock with 400 Danqing
  • Lion’s Mane Spray – Unlock with 500 Danqing
  • 200 Chrono Tokens – Unlock with 600 Danqing
  • Lion Roll Star-Lord Emote – Unlock with 700 Danqing
  • Lion Dance Star-Lord MVP Movie – Unlock with 800 Danqing
  • Lion’s Mane Star-Lord Costume – Unlock with 900 Danqing
  • Of Festivals and Friends Gallery Card – Unlock with 1000 Danqing

When your progress reaches 100% and the painting is complete, you will be handed an event memento as the final reward. The debate around GTA 6's "physical" edition just got another twist. Rockstar has confirmed on its official website that PS5 download codes included with physical copies of Grand Theft Auto VI sold in Japan will expire 170 days after the game's November 19, 2026 launch date. That means players who don't redeem the code before roughly May 8, 2027 could be left with nothing more than an empty game box, even though they purchased a physical copy. The company says the policy is required due to regional regulations in Japan.
